NEON Festival: Street Soccer Tournament

From the event description:

Vibes Football Club is hosting a 4 v 4 street soccer tournament at this year's NEON Festival. This tournament will take place in the D'Art's lower level parking garage. Half of the garage will be used for our tournament, and the other for a dance party.

When: Thursday, Oct. 17, 5:30-10 p.m.
Where: The Underground Palace, 740 Duke St., Lower Level Parking Garage
Admission: Free

EVMS Medical Adventures Ultrasound Night

From the event description:

Learn how ultrasound is used to scan different organs, develop an understanding for how to interpret ultrasounds and scan real people!

When: Thursday, Oct. 17, 6:30-9 p.m.
Where: Lester Hall, 700 W. Olney Road
Admission: Free
